11 short scripts: 3-5 minutes.
Aim: To inform, clarify, educate and equip. And to support and respond to questions of viewers after they have viewed the production via Whatsapp or online chat.
In these difficult times, the general public, chaplains, soldiers, their children are struggling with many questions:
Where is God? Does He care? Why the suffering? How do I approach God? Is He aproachable? How does He make sense in the world we live in?
Program titles:
- Who is God and what makes Him unique?
- Who is God and what makes Him unique - continue
- What do followers of God believe?
- God and Creation.
- The Fall of mankind.
- Man's condition after the Fall.
- God's Commitment to mankind.
- A Promise of Hope.
- The Purpose of life and the Christlike lifestyle.
- What is Sin and where does it come from?
- What is Faith and how does it work?
This is mainly for people who:
- question their own faith,
- find it hard to give account of their own faith,
- feel confused by all the faith systems and need to make sense of it all,
- find it hard to explain their faith to their children,
- find that the struggles of life overshadow their faith,
- find it hard to make sense of God in a suffering world,
- blame God for bad things that happened to them or their loved ones
